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Water Orton to Kinghorn start from as little as £25.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Water Orton to Kinghorn start from £177.40 one way, or £178.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Water Orton to Kinghorn are available for £187.70 one way, or £364.00 return

Station Amenities and Ticketing

Despite its small size, Water Orton station is equipped to handle the essentials. There is no ticket office, but 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ets bought online, making your journey just a tap away. However, it's important to note that these machines are not equipped with accessibility features, so plan ahead if you require additional assistance. An induction loop is available, enhancing the station’s aid for those with hearing aids.

Help and Accessibility

Travelers will find a help point for any questions or concerns, though staffed assistance is unavailable. Step-free access is offered in certain parts of the station, but a full barrier-free experience is lacking, categorized as a step-free access category C station. There are no waiting rooms or first-class lounges, but the venue ensures basic seating arrangements are in place for your comfort.

Facilities and Amenities

Kinghorn Station is well-equipped to ensure your travel is as seamless as possible. Though it doesn’t have ticket machines, a ticket office is available for purchasing and collecting online tickets from Monday to Saturday. This station is accessible to those with mobility needs and features an induction loop for the hearing impaired. Feel free to use the accessible toilets situated on platform 2, which also include baby changing facilities.

For those who enjoy a leisurely wait, there is a seating area where you can relax before your journey. Keep in mind there are no refreshment facilities or ATM machines, but an artist studio provides a unique shopping experience at the station.

Transport Links

Thanks to its comprehensive transport links, Kinghorn Station is within easy reach of many destinations. If rail services are unavailable, a rail replacement bus service is offered and can be accessed just a short walk from the station. Visit the exact location for details concerning bus pick-up. Taxis are another convenient option, with more information available at TraxOnline.

For local bus services, further information can be obtained by visiting Traveline Scotland or calling their 24-hour hotline. There aren’t any cycle hire facilities at the station, but there is bicycle storage if you choose to bring your own set of wheels.
